Eva Kennedy

Eva Kennedy is a Staff Attorney at Legal Clinic For Disabled Inc since May 2022, with prior experiences as a Legal Intern at Citizens for Juvenile Justice, Greater Boston Legal Services, and Lawyers for Civil Rights. Additionally, Eva served as a Student Attorney at Greater Boston Legal Services. Educational qualifications include a Doctor of Law (JD) degree from Northeastern University obtained in 2020 and a Bachelor's degree in History from Louisiana State University, completed in 2016.

Legal Clinic for the Disabled

The Legal Clinic for the Disabled (LCD) provides free legal services to low-income people with disabilities and to the deaf and hard of hearing in Philadelphia, Bucks, Chester, Delaware and Montgomery Counties. Since 1987, LCD, a 501(c)(3) non-profit corporation with offices at Magee Rehabilitation Hospital, has helped thousands of Pennsylvanians with disabilities. At LCD, we provide a variety of legal services. As part of our work, we assist victims of domestic violence with getting legal protection from their abusers. We represent victims of identity theft and consumer fraud. We help parents and caregivers access healthcare for their children. We write wills, powers of attorney and living wills. Most of the clients we serve experience physical limitations in their daily activities, and many have suffered catastrophic injuries or illnesses like stroke, spinal cord or brain injury, multiple sclerosis, cancer, advanced diabetes, glaucoma, AIDS, amputation or epilepsy. Our services help them overcome legal barriers that impact their ability to live safely and independently in their communities.
